Prepare inflationary universe via the Euclidean charged wormhole

Published 21 Nov 2024 in gr-qc and hep-th | (2411.13844v1)

Abstract: In this paper, we present a wavefunction of the universe, which correspond to an Euclidean charged wineglass (half)-wormholes semiclassically, as a possible creation for our inflationary universe. We calculate the Euclidean action of the charged wormhole, and find that the initial state of universe brought by such an Euclidean charged wormhole can exhibit a high probability weight for a long period of inflation. We compare our result with that of axion wormholes, and evaluate the potential of other corresponding Euclidean configurations as the pre-inflationary initial states.
